What is NZD/JPY on MT5?
NZD/JPY on MT5 represents the exchange rate between the New Zealand dollar and the Japanese yen, quoted as how many yen per NZD. For Belize traders, this pair offers volatility driven by commodity prices and risk sentiment, with pip movements directly impacting USD-denominated accounts. A pip in NZD/JPY is 0.01 yen, and for a standard lot (100,000 units), the pip value in USD is approximately $10.11 when NZD/USD is 0.60. For example, a Belize trader in the capital with a $5,000 USD account opens a 0.1 lot position at 90.00. If the price moves 20 pips to 89.80, the loss is 20 × $1.01 = $20.20 USD, or 0.4% of the account. MT5's interface displays real-time pip values in the account currency, simplifying risk calculation. The pair is active during Asian and London sessions, with tightest spreads during the 13:00-16:30 UTC+0 overlap. Belize traders can use MT5's built-in tools like Fibonacci retracements and moving averages to analyze NZD/JPY trends. With USDT TRC20 deposits and 1:500 leverage, even small accounts can trade this pair effectively. Remember that NZD/JPY is sensitive to New Zealand dairy prices and Japanese monetary policy, so stay updated on economic calendars.

Islamic accounts & swap fees - Belize
Islamic accounts, or swap-free accounts, are available for Belize traders who wish to avoid interest charges on overnight NZD/JPY positions. These accounts are offered by AvaTrade, Exness, IC Markets, XM Group, Fusion Markets, OctaFX, HotForex HFM, Vantage, eToro, and FBS. For NZD/JPY, swap fees reflect the interest rate differential between New Zealand and Japan—currently positive for long positions (earning interest) and negative for shorts. In Belize, standard swap rates can be 0.5-1.5 pips per night, but Islamic accounts waive these fees entirely. This is beneficial for swing traders holding positions for days. Note that Islamic accounts may have restrictions, such as no weekend swaps or limits on holding periods. Check with your broker for eligibility—most require a declaration of faith. Using an Islamic account in Belize ensures your trading aligns with Sharia law while accessing low spreads on NZD/JPY.
Risk management - Belize
Risk management for NZD/JPY trading from Belize starts with account sizing in USD. A typical Belize trader using a $2,000 USD account should risk only 1-2% per trade, or $20-$40. Given NZD/JPY's average daily range of 50-80 pips, a stop-loss of 20 pips on a 0.1 lot position ($1.01 pip value) limits loss to $20.20. Use MT5's risk calculator to set lot sizes automatically. Leverage of 1:500 amplifies gains but also losses, so avoid overleveraging. Belize traders should diversify across pairs and avoid concentrated NZD/JPY exposure during RBNZ events. The 13:00-16:30 overlap offers lower volatility, but always use trailing stops to lock profits. Regularly review your risk-reward ratio—target at least 1:2 on each trade. Keep an economic calendar handy for Japanese and New Zealand data releases.
